find the slope of (1, -9) (-3, -10)

the slope is 1/4. You can find that by 1. Graphing it and counting or 2. use the equation y1-y2 over x1-x2. (Take the y in one position and minus the other from it, then using the same position, do that with the xs.) Hope that helps:)
